On Sun, 2003-07-27 at 21:51, Neil Blue wrote:
> Hello,
>
> I am using mandrake 9.1. I have downloaded both the kmldonkey 0.8 rpm and the
> kmldonkey 0.9 tarball. I installed kml0.8 and all seemed fine, except I am
> running my mldonkey core on a remote machine and I could not find a way to
> configure kmldonkey to connect to a remote core. I then tried the 0.9
> tarball, following the readme instructions. I didn't get a menu option but
> kmldonkey started from the command line. I then tried to configure the
> connection (a new fearture not in 0.8, and which I assumed I would need to
> connect to a remote core), but the dialog did not appear. From this I guess
> that I need to install the tarball differently for mandrake 9.1. Please can
> anyone tell me how to do this.
It definitely sounds like some files haven't been installed in the right
places - Mandrake is notorious for keeping important KDE files in places
other than where they're installed by default. Unfortunately, I don't
know how to fix it, as I don't use Mandrake myself. If you look through
the mailing list archives, you might be able to find something helpful;
I know this issue was discussed before.
